Christopher Nolan sends viewers into space with new ‘Interstellar’ teaser

After bending minds with “Inception” and reinventing superheroes with his “Dark Knight” trilogy, Christopher Nolan is sending viewers to space with “Interstellar,” his mysterious new sci-fi film. 

As very little is known about the plot — apparently something to do with wormholes, time travel and alternate dimensions — the brand new teaser doesn’t reveal much in that department. Likewise, the only member of the crazy huge cast that we glimpse is leading man Matthew McConaughey, who continues his recent renaissance. 

At a time when space exploration has been curtailed, the teaser offers a solemn and impassioned plea to not abandon the natural impulse to explore and find out what lies beyond our fragile little rock of a planet. McConaughey solemnly intones over clips of the Bell X-1, the moon landing and more recent achievements, “Our destiny lies above us.” Some downright spiritual music (frequent Nolan collaborator Hans Zimmer is scoring) underlines the clip’s wondrous testimony to the human spirit. “The Right Stuff” was just the beginning. 

“Interstellar” also stars Anne Hathaway, Jessica Chastain, Bill Irwin, Ellen Burstyn, Michael Caine, Casey Affleck and Matt Damon. We may have to wait for the full trailer to see them though. 

It’s also Nolan’s first film without DP Wally Pfister — who was busy making his directorial debut with “Transcendence” — but Hoyte van Hoytema (“Let the Right One In,” “Her”) seems like an inspired choice as a substitute.

“Interstellar” opens November 7, 2014.
